Insurance, Fees, and Intake Forms
Key Points Counseling works with select insurance plans, and participation may vary by therapist and service. If you plan to use insurance, your coverage information may be reviewed before services begin whenever possible.
Depending on your plan, your financial responsibility may include:
- A copay, coinsurance, or deductible
- The full contracted rate until your deductible is met
- Services that are not covered by your plan
Insurance benefits are determined by your insurance company and can change, so any benefit information shared before treatment is an estimate rather than a guarantee of payment. Private-pay options are also available, and we'll help clarify the fee and payment expectations for your care before you begin.

Your First Session and Beyond
A common question before therapy is: "What am I supposed to talk about?" There's no wrong answer. Your first session is an opportunity for you and your therapist to begin getting to know one another, understand your concerns, and discuss your goals. It's also a chance for you to get a feel for the fit, ask questions, and share what has or hasn't worked for you before.
Therapy works best when it's collaborative. Your therapist brings clinical knowledge, you bring expertise about your life, and together you determine where the work goes next.
As you and your therapist learn more about what's bringing you to therapy, you'll shape goals together for your care.

You don't have to come to every session with a breakthrough. Some sessions build a skill, examine a recent experience, or simply give you a place to process what's happening. Over time, therapy helps you move from recognizing patterns to responding to them differently, and your therapist will periodically revisit your goals with you along the way.
The goal isn't perfect progress. The goal is meaningful progress.
